J'ai trois contrôleurs assez similaires. Je veux avoir un contrôleur dont ces trois éléments étendent et partagent ses
J'ai trois contrôleurs assez similaires. Je veux avoir un contrôleur dont ces trois éléments étendent et partagent ses
Fermé . Cette question est basée sur l'opinion . Il n'accepte pas les réponses actuellement. Vous souhaitez améliorer cette question? Mettez à jour la question afin de pouvoir y répondre avec des faits et des citations en éditant ce message . Fermé il y a 5 ans . Améliorez cette question Parfois,...
Je veux utiliser le même {% block%} deux fois dans le même modèle django. Je veux que ce bloc apparaisse plus d'une fois dans mon modèle de base: # base.html <html> <head> <title>{% block title %}My Cool Website{% endblock %}</title> </head> <body> <h1>{%...
J'ai gâché plusieurs tests unitaires il y a quelque temps lorsque je les ai refactorisés pour les rendre plus SECS - l'intention de chaque test n'était plus claire. Il semble qu'il y ait un compromis entre la lisibilité et la maintenabilité des tests. Si je laisse du code dupliqué dans les tests...
Fermé . Cette question est basée sur l'opinion . Il n'accepte pas les réponses actuellement. Vous souhaitez améliorer cette question? Mettez à jour la question afin de pouvoir y répondre avec des faits et des citations en éditant ce message . Fermé l'année dernière . Améliorez cette question La...
J'ai un code Java simple qui ressemble à ceci dans sa structure: abstract public class BaseClass { String someString; public BaseClass(String someString) { this.someString = someString; } abstract public String getName(); } public class ACSubClass extends BaseClass { public ASubClass(String...
Je travaille actuellement sur un interpréteur simple pour un langage de programmation et j'ai un type de données comme celui-ci: data Expr = Variable String | Number Int | Add [Expr] | Sub Expr Expr Et j'ai de nombreuses fonctions qui font des choses simples comme: -- Substitute a value for a...
L'objectif est de construire un programme pour convertir les scores d'un système «0 à 1» en un système «F à A»: Si score >= 0.9imprimerait 'A' Si score >= 0.8imprimerait «B» 0,7, C 0,6, D Et toute valeur en dessous de ce point, imprimez F C'est la façon de le construire et cela fonctionne sur...
(Inspiré par ma réponse à cette question .) Considérez ce code (il est censé trouver le plus grand élément inférieur ou égal à une entrée donnée): data TreeMap v = Leaf | Node Integer v (TreeMap v) (TreeMap v) deriving (Show, Read, Eq, Ord) closestLess :: Integer -> TreeMap v -> Maybe...